Output 531b86d8904aeb4e8d63e0fdde4e12781e9e557abdccc939ccc71e57a412d84e:0

value
429652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9f686d325ecb1e6d8fb0198bfcffbc3f926a264 OP_EQUAL
address
3QUhWHKH6qz3qeaB4bag7QU2c4WJD6EJn2
transaction
531b86d8904aeb4e8d63e0fdde4e12781e9e557abdccc939ccc71e57a412d84e
confirmations
292778
spent
true